The article discusses the expansive history and ongoing evolution of the Star Wars franchise, noting how it has delivered multiple 'endings' across different films and series. Unlike most series, the recent finale of Andor is highlighted as a significant moment, providing a clear conclusion after two short seasons. As Disney+ changes direction, the future of Star Wars on television remains uncertain, but Andor's completion seems to symbolize a meaningful connection to Rogue One, making it potentially the definitive series finale in the franchise's vast narrative history.
Star Wars has transitioned from the cinematic realm into a vast streaming universe, yet Andor stands out as a unique series finale in this ongoing franchise.
The closure of Andor not only connects to Rogue One but reflects on the evolving nature of the Star Wars narrative landscape in an era dominated by franchises.
